端面粗车循环通常使用G72指令,适用于圆柱棒料毛坯端面方向的粗车加工。其编程格式如下:
```
G72 W(d)R(f);
G72 P(ns)Q(nf)U(u)W(w)F—S-;
```
其中:
`W(d)`:每次吃刀深度,沿Z轴线方向。
`R(f)`:退刀距离。
`P(ns)`:循环程序中第一个程序段的次序号。
`Q(nf)`:循环程序中最后一个程序段的次序号。
`U(u)`:径向(X轴方向)的精车余量(直径值)。
`W(w)`:轴向(Z轴方向)的精车余量。
编程实例
1. 设置坐标系和对刀点:
```
O9005: 程序名
G50 X40 Z3: 设置坐标系,定义对刀点的位置
```
2. 主轴转速和进给速度:
```
M03 S400: 主轴以400转/分钟的速度旋转
F100: 进给速度为100mm/min
```
3. 刀具移动到加工位置:
```
G94: 端面车削循环
X30 Z-30: 刀具移动到X30, Z-30的位置
I-5.5: X轴方向的偏移量
```
4. 返回到起始位置:
```
G98: 返回到R点的模式
```
5. 结束程序:
```
M30: 程序结束
```
建议
确保在编程前仔细检查零件的几何尺寸和加工要求,以选择合适的切削参数和循环指令。
使用合适的切削速度和进给量,以确保加工效率和表面质量。
在编程过程中,注意检查刀具路径和加工顺序,避免发生碰撞或干涉。